Tamil fonts use strange encoding but claim to be Unicode

Bug #190388 reported by Vincent Lönngren
16
This bug affects 3 people
Affects Status Importance Assigned to Milestone
ttf-indic-fonts (Ubuntu)
Confirmed
Undecided
Unassigned

Bug Description

DISTRIB_ID=Ubuntu
DISTRIB_RELEASE=7.10
DISTRIB_CODENAME=gutsy
DISTRIB_DESCRIPTION="Ubuntu 7.10"

ttf-tamil-fonts 1:0.5.0-0ubuntu1

These fonts are reported in the hint file to be encoded with unicode, yet the actual encoding seems to be something different because the glyphs are in different positions.

Revision history for this message
Daniel T Chen (crimsun) wrote :

Is this symptom still reproducible in 8.10 or 9.04?

Changed in ttf-tamil-fonts:
status: New → Incomplete
Revision history for this message
Vincent Lönngren (bice77) wrote :

Yes. When I open them in fontforge the glyphs of these fonts seem to be in the wrong place a lot of the time - at least not in the place you'd expect with the unicode encoding.

Revision history for this message
Kess Vargavind (kess) wrote :

This still is true with Karmic.

All fonts TAMu_* and TSCu_* have Tamil characters in the Latin-1 Supplement block. And then more are scattered here and there. As an example, the TAMu_Kadambri font:

  0041–005A, 0061–007A, 007E–0081, 00A0–00A8, 00AA–00B6, 00B8–00C9,
  00CB–00D1, 00D6–00FF, 0152, 0153, 0160, 0161, 0178, 0192, 02C6,
  02DC, 0B83, 0B85–0B8A, 0B8E–0B90, 0B92–0B95, 0B99, 0B9A, 0B9C, 0B9E,
  0B9F, 0BA3, 0BA4, 0BA8–0BAA, 0BAE–0BB5, 0BB7–0BB9, 0BBE–0BC2,
  0BC6–0BC8, 0BCA–0BCC, 0BD7, 2013, 2014, 2018–201A, 201C–201E,
  2020–2022, 2026, 2030, 2039, 203A, 2122, 10000–10003

Arne Goetje (arnegoetje)
Changed in ttf-indic-fonts (Ubuntu):
status: Incomplete → Confirmed
Revision history for this message
Mechanical snail (replicator-snail) wrote :

Still there in Maverick (package name apparently changed)

summary: - Strange encoding
+ Tamil fonts use strange encoding but claim to be Unicode
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.